As a Deputy Manager, you will:
Support the Registered Manager with the day-to-day running of a 30-bedded supported living service. Lead, motivate and develop a team of support workers and senior staff. Ensure consistently high standards of person-centred care and support. Assist with staff rotas, recruitment, supervision, appraisals and training. Maintain compliance with CQC regulations, safeguarding procedures and internal policies. Support care planning, risk assessments and reviews to ensure individual needs are met. Monitor quality, performance and service delivery, identifying areas for improvement. Build positive relationships with families, healthcare professionals, commissioners and external agencies.
